Four-Grain Yogurt Pancakes

Description
A great, healthy start to the day. Kids love to help mix the batter.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up unbleached flour
  • 1/2 cup whole-wheat flour
  • 2 tablespoons each: cornmeal, soy flour, wheat germ and oat bran
  • 2 teaspoons ba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ons sugar
  • 2 large Horizon Organic eggs
  • 2 tablespoons Horizon Organic unsalted butter, melted
  • 2 cups Horizon Organic fat-free plain yogurt
  • 3/4 cup Horizon Organic fat-free milk

Preparation
Prep time: 15 minutes | Cooking time: 5 to 10 minutes per batch

In large mixing bowl, combine flours and grains, baking powder, baking soda and sugar. Beat in eggs, melted butter, yogurt and fat-free milk. Batter will be lumpy. Lightly oil hot griddle. Bake pancakes on griddle at medium temperature. Serve immediately with butter, fresh fruit and syrup.

Nutrition
Nutrients per serving: 125 calories; 3g total fat; 2g saturated fat; 41 mg cholesterol; 230mg sodium; 18g carbohydrates; 1g dietary fiber; 4g sugars; 6g protein; vitamin A 3% DV; vitamin C 1% DV; calcium 13% DV; iron 6% DV

Serves
Yield: About 12 pancakes
